Tech Men's Tennis Opens Season Against Mississippi State at Southern Intercollegiate Scramble

Sept. 13, 2002

Athens, Ga. – The Georgia Tech men’s tennis team opened its 2002-03 campaign by facing Mississippi State on the first day of play at the Southern Intercollegiate Scramble at the Dan Magill Tennis Center on the campus of the University of Georgia in Athens, Ga.

The Yellow Jackets opened the day by splitting a pair of doubles matches with the Bulldogs, as the tournament features a modified dual-match format. Tech’s tandem of Joao Menano and Marko Rajevac defeated Mississippi State’s team of Matt Armstrong and Max Fomine in solid fashion by an 8-2 count at No. 2 doubles. The Jackets’ team of West Nott and Scott Schnugg fell to the Bulldogs’ tandem of Rene-Charles Combette and Jerome Le Belicard at No. 1 in a tight, 9-8 (5) match.

In singles action, a pair of Tech newcomers, Rajevac and Trevor McLeod picked up wins in their first action as Yellow Jackets. Rajevac was a winner at No. 4 singles as he downed Armstrong in straight sets by scores of 6-3 and 6-2. McLeod was even more impressive in his first outing as a collegian, cruising past Mississippi State’s Michael Hailey in straight sets by a score of 6-1, 6-0.

In other singles action, the Bulldogs’ Rene-Charles Combette defeated Tech’s Scott Schnugg in a hard-fought match at No. 1 singles. Schnugg won the first set by a 6-4 score, before dropping the next two by close scores of 7-5 and 6-4. At the No. 2 spot in the lineup, the Jackets’ Joao Menano fell in three sets to MSU”s Jerome Le Belicard. Menano lost the first set by a 6-4 score before rallying to win the second set 6-3. Le Belicard then won the third set, and the match, by a 6-4 count. West Nott was the final singles competitor of the day for the Jackets, dropping the first set to the Bulldogs’ Max Fomine at No. 3 singles by a 6-3 score before retiring from the match.

The Yellow Jackets are slated to face ACC rival Duke on Saturday beginning at 2 p.m., with Georgia scheduled to square off with Mississippi State at 10 a.m. Should inclement weather affect the outdoor courts in Athens, the matches will be moved to the indoor courts at the Bill Moore Tennis Center on the campus of Georgia Tech.

GEORGIA TECH VS. MISSISSIPPI STATE

SINGLES 1. Rene-Charles Combette (MS) d. Scott Schnugg (GT), 4-6, 7-5, 6-4 2. Jerome Le Belicard (MS) d. Joao Menano (GT), 6-4, 3-6, 6-4 3. Max Fomine (MS) d. West Nott (GT), 6-3, Ret. 4. Marko Rajevac (GT) d. Matt Armstrong (MS), 6-3, 6-2 5. Trevor McLeod (GT) d. Michael Hailey (MS), 6-1, 6-0

DOUBLES 1. Combette/Belicard (MS) d. Nott/Schnugg (GT), 9-8 (5) 2. Menano/Schnugg (GT) d. Armstrong/Fomine (MS), 8-2
